Transaction 3e514ddca2b15c519247a31c55e656b10f439b17e1682fe48ef5bfc20b368ed3
1 Input
1 Output
-
3e514ddca2b15c519247a31c55e656b10f439b17e1682fe48ef5bfc20b368ed3:0
- value
- 14978068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bfbdb5944d819dda209ac467b7c69e13e17071b OP_EQUAL
- address
- 3BXywPWrgKfdazT3V34CDygAJWxusqiwUU